Senin, 09 Mei 2016

Migrasi dari Relational Database ke Dokumen Berorientasi Database: Struktur Denormalization dan Transformasi data


         Relasional Database (RDM) telah menjadi teknologi penyimpanan data terkemuka selama bertahun-tahun. Namun demikian, perubahan tuntutan untuk pengolahan data telah menyebabkan munculnya penyimpanan data, pengambilan dan pengolahan mekanisme baru. Salah satu mekanisme tersebut adalah NoSQL (Tidak hanya SQL) database yang telah diperkenalkan untuk label non-relasional dan didistribusikan menyimpan data. Untuk mengurangi biaya operasional, manajer dari banyak perusahaan besar berharap untuk solusi komputasi awan. Solusi ini membantu untuk menyimpan data secara efisien, untuk menghitung jumlah besar data, untuk menyediakan skalabilitas tinggi, untuk memastikan kinerja tinggi dan ketersediaan dengan biaya rendah. database hubungan yang tidak sesuai untuk komputasi awan, tapi database NoSQL yang.         Pasar database NoSQL masih kecil tapi stabil tumbuh. Semakin banyak perusahaan yang mencoba untuk mengeksploitasi database NoSQL untuk meningkatkan bisnis. Artikel [1] menjelaskan satu seperti contoh - CarFax perusahaan yang menawarkan kendaraan secara online dan situs valuasi. CarFax memiliki 13,6 miliar catatan yang terkait dengan 700 juta kendaraan, dan itu sulit untuk menjalankan sebuah website yang menggunakan database relasional. Perusahaan ini sekarang menjalankan situs web yang didasarkan pada NoSQL Database MongoDB (108 server, 10,6 TB data, 1,5 miliar dokumen kendaraan, sistem baru bekerja lima kali lebih cepat dari warisan satu).Berbagai estimasi ada tentang masa depan NoSQL pasar database, tapi semua memprediksi peningkatan yang signifikan dari saham. Perusahaan Penelitian dan Pasar diperkirakan pasar NoSQL akan tumbuh pada CAGR 53,09 persen dibanding periode 2013-2018 [2]. CAGR merupakan indikator yang menunjukkan tingkat pertumbuhan tahun-ke-tahun dari investasi selama periode tertentu. Perusahaan Allied Market Research memperkirakan CAGR 40,8% selama 2014-2020 dan NoSQL global yang pasar diperkirakan akan mencapai $ 4200000000 pada tahun 2020 [3]. Segmen yang paling signifikan dari aplikasi penyimpanan data, penyimpanan metadata, cache memory, data terdistribusi penyimpanan, e-commerce, aplikasi mobile, aplikasi web, analisis data, jaringan sosial.Ada lima jenis database NoSQL saat ini: kolom, dokumen, kunci-nilai, grafik, multi-model. Jenis yang paling penting untuk beberapa tahun ke depan toko kunci-nilai dan database dokumen. Kami memusatkan perhatian kita pada database dokumen dan memanggil mereka database berorientasi dokumen (beberapa notasi exit - database dokumen, database yang berorientasi dokumen, menyimpan dokumen). Ada berbagai database berorientasi dokumen, misalnya, MongoDB, Couchbase server, database CouchDB, MarkLogic, Cloudant, Cassandra, dan Clusterpoint.
         Menawarkan migrasi data dari database relasional ke dalam database berorientasi dokumen dapat digunakan dalam praktek. Kami termasuk fitur konversi data ke dalam alat database yang penjelajahan relasional DigiBrowser. Pengembang database berorientasi document- Clusterpoint approbated DigiBrowser dan diubah 'database untuk 1,5 juta pasien pasien warisan dokumen dalam beberapa hari. spesialis IT tidak akrab dengan database yang diberikan dan dipaksa untuk mengeksplorasi database dengan DigiBrowser sebelum membuat model data logis dan mendefinisikan template mengkonversi. Jika database relasional tidak besar, adalah mungkin membuat migrasi database relasional setiap hari. Database NoSQL dapat menyediakan layanan tambahan untuk sistem warisan seperti informasi yang lebih baik mencari dan presentasi. Penelitian lebih lanjut harus dilakukan untuk meningkatkan metode yang diberikan. Berbagai algoritma baru mungkin dibuat untuk mengenali jenis meja, mendefinisikan struktur dokumen, memilih bidang untuk migrasi, dan membentuk dokumen Target.

Tidak ada komentar:

Posting Komentar